Android 如何在Eclipse中跨多个项目创建共享源文件夹?

Android 如何在Eclipse中跨多个项目创建共享源文件夹?,android,eclipse,ide,Android,Eclipse,Ide,我一直在看Google IO会话中的Android+应用程序引擎源代码。它们生成了三个项目,一个Android项目、一个GWT接口和一个应用引擎服务器项目。所有这些项目都有一个名为shared的公共源文件夹,可以在其中放置应用程序所有部分都需要知道的同步数据类 我想知道如何在通用Eclipse项目中创建共享源文件夹。如何在一个项目中创建一个源文件夹,该文件夹也可用于Eclipse中的其他项目并与之同步 编辑 我不是在寻找如何做一个Android库项目(我已经在我的应用程序中使用了其中的几个)。A

我一直在看Google IO会话中的Android+应用程序引擎源代码。它们生成了三个项目,一个Android项目、一个GWT接口和一个应用引擎服务器项目。所有这些项目都有一个名为shared的公共源文件夹,可以在其中放置应用程序所有部分都需要知道的同步数据类

我想知道如何在通用Eclipse项目中创建共享源文件夹。如何在一个项目中创建一个源文件夹,该文件夹也可用于Eclipse中的其他项目并与之同步

编辑

我不是在寻找如何做一个Android库项目(我已经在我的应用程序中使用了其中的几个)。Android库不适用于通用eclipse项目,比如应用程序引擎服务器端项目

在Android中实现这一点的方法是使用库项目。创建一个项目作为Android库(properties->Android->Is library已被选中),其他项目必须更新其属性页才能使用该库


库将其代码和资源拉入使用库的项目中。库的清单被忽略。

我正在使用Helios eclipse

创建源文件夹的步骤 在包资源管理器中导航到您的项目,右键单击并选择“新建”,然后选择“源文件夹”。输入文件夹名称,然后单击“完成”


如果要在任何项目中使用源文件夹,请转到项目属性,单击Java Build Path,转到source选项卡,您可以链接该文件夹。

我知道如何使用库项目,事实上我使用了其中的几个。我的问题是如何在Eclipse中实现这一点。假设我有一个服务器端版本和客户端版本,两者都需要一个公共的可序列化类。我知道有一种方法可以创建这样的共享源文件夹。我明白了。你可以编辑你的问题来删除Android标签,因为你的意思是!有关如何创建到其他项目文件夹的相对链接,请参阅。